Mat and rug difference

The key difference between rug and mat is that the rug is a thick and heavy floor covering that does not extend over the entire floor whereas the mat is a piece of coarse material placed on a floor for people to wipe their feet on. Bath mats and bath rugs each have their own specific purpose. They also feature different aesthetics, so it is important to know details about each so you can properly choose between a bath mat vs bath rug for your family. What is a Bath Mat? Bath mats are used right in front of your bathtub or shower to absorb water after you bathe. They are typically extra absorbent and offer non-skid features for safety. What is a Bath Rug? Bath rugs can be coordinated with your bathroom theme and can match curtains, towels, and shower curtains to complete a look. They can be used anywhere in your bathroom and are not limited to the front of your bathtub or shower. The main difference between a bath mat and a bath rug is that while very pretty, bath mats tend to be more functional, while bath rugs are plush and give a more luxurious feel to the space. These items are similar in that they are a piece of covering on a floor. However, there are some important differences that should make it clear. Also, a carpet is usually cut to the exact size and shape of the room, and is installed and attached to the floor so it cannot move around. Once you place it, it stays there usually until you want to throw it away and get a new carpet. Also, in the US at least, a carpet often does not have a pattern; it is just one color. A RUG, in contrast, is usually smaller than carpet and covers only part of a floor. It is not attached so the floor, so you can easily move it to different parts of a room, or even different rooms.
